About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Help building a world-class team to redefine knowledge work with AI
  • take ownership of Zeno’s early legal partnerships in Germany.
  • Means you will build and manage relationships with law firms, notaries, and legal departments in Germany;
  • support legal, regulatory, and compliance matters relevant to operating an AI company in Germany and Europe;
  • help develop internal policies, legal processes, and governance frameworks;
  • identify where Zeno can create real value in legal research, drafting, review, and knowledge work;
  • collaborate with product and engineering teams on legal questions relating to AI, data protection, and responsible product development;
  • work with product and legal teams to bring market feedback back into the company;
  • serve as a legal subject matter expert internally and help ensure that Zeno maintains the high standards expected by legal professionals.
  • represent Zeno at legal tech events, law firm meetings and relevant industry conversations
  • You will not be handed a rigid playbook. You will help write it.

Requirements

What you’ll need
  • You are a qualified lawyer, legal counsel or senior legal professional with strong exposure to sophisticated legal work and a deep understanding of the German legal market.
  • You enjoy practicing law, but you are equally excited by the opportunity to help shape how technology transforms the legal profession.
  • strong German legal market knowledge and an understanding of how law firms, legal departments, and legal professionals evaluate new technologies;
  • experience at a leading law firm, legal department, legal tech company, or legal innovation team;
  • excellent German and English communication skills;
  • strong legal judgment and the ability to identify, assess, and manage legal and commercial risks;
  • experience advising on commercial agreements, strategic projects, regulatory matters, or client-facing legal work;
  • the ability to build credibility quickly with partners, general counsels, legal operations teams, and other senior stakeholders;
  • confidence leading negotiations, commercial discussions, and partnership conversations;
  • curiosity about AI, legal workflows, and the future of legal services;
  • enough independence to build and own a market without waiting for detailed instructions;
  • strong business instincts and an appreciation for how legal advice supports commercial outcomes;
  • good judgment on when to push, when to listen, and when to bring in others.
